Senovio S Padilla 1948 - 1993

Senovio S Padilla of Santa Fe, Santa Fe County, NM was born on December 16, 1948, and died at age 44 years old on February 3, 1993. Senovio Padilla was buried at Santa Fe National Cemetery Section 9 Site 2456 501 North Guadalupe Street, in Santa Fe.
